Abstract
A computer-implemented method of monitoring dynamics of patient brain state during neurosurgical procedures includes receiving a plurality of brain response images acquired using a functional MRI scan of a patient over a plurality of time points and selecting a plurality of image features from the brain response images. One or more recurrent neural network (RNN) model are used to directly estimate one or more brain state measurements at each time point based on the image features. Once estimated, the brain state measurements are presented on a display.
